Web14 mrt. 2024 · First, reveal the sides of the palm stump (you can use a shovel to dig around it). Step 2. Drill holes (12 inches deep and 1 inch in diameter) in the stump’s top and sides. Step 3. Pour tree stump killer into the holes as indicated on the package. Step 4. Pour hot water into the holes so the granules can dissolve and start working. When wondering what to do with stump grinding debris, the best answer is to make mulch. This is the most common and practical use for leftover stump grindings. Stump grindings make for excellent mulch.
